Render (RNDR) Price Prediction: Foundation and Market Context
The Render Network fundamentally connects users needing GPU rendering power with providers who have spare capacity. Consequently, the RNDR token serves as the network’s utility medium. Market analysts consistently track several key metrics. These include network adoption rates, total rendering jobs processed, and the expansion of the node operator base. Furthermore, broader cryptocurrency market cycles significantly influence its price action. Historical data from 2021 to 2024 shows a strong correlation between RNDR’s price and demand for digital rendering services.
Several institutional reports highlight the growing market for GPU cloud services. For instance, a 2024 analysis by Gartner projected the market to exceed $90 billion by 2028. Render Network directly competes in this sector with a decentralized model. Its technological roadmap includes major upgrades. The transition to the Solana blockchain aims to drastically reduce transaction costs and increase throughput. This technical evolution forms a critical basis for any long-term RNDR price prediction.

Risks, Challenges, and Competitive Landscape
No forecast is complete without a rigorous risk assessment. The Render Network faces distinct challenges. Competition from centralized cloud providers like AWS and Google Cloud is intense. These competitors have vast capital and existing enterprise relationships. Additionally, other decentralized compute projects are emerging. The network must continuously innovate to maintain its technological edge.
Regulatory developments present another layer of uncertainty. The classification of utility tokens like RNDR varies by jurisdiction. Favorable regulation could unlock institutional participation. Conversely, restrictive policies could hinder growth in key markets. The team’s execution capability remains paramount. Successful delivery of roadmap milestones, such as the full integration with Solana and development of Layer-2 solutions, is non-negotiable for achieving long-term price targets.

FAQs
Q1: What is the primary use case for the RNDR token?The RNDR token is primarily used as a payment medium within the Render Network. Artists use it to pay for GPU rendering services, while node operators earn it for providing their spare computational power.
Q2: How does the migration to the Solana blockchain affect RNDR’s future?The migration aims to solve scalability and cost issues associated with the previous Ethereum-based system. Lower transaction fees and faster speeds on Solana could significantly increase network usage and utility demand for the token.
Q3: What are the biggest risks to this long-term RNDR price prediction?Key risks include intense competition from centralized cloud providers, failure to execute technological upgrades, adverse cryptocurrency regulations, and a prolonged downturn in the broader digital asset market.
Q4: Does Render Network have competitors in the decentralized GPU space?Yes, while it is a pioneer, other projects like Akash Network and Golem offer generalized decentralized compute. Render’s main competitive advantage is its specific focus on the graphics rendering vertical and its established community of artists.
Q5: What metrics should I watch to gauge Render Network’s health, beyond price?Critical metrics include the total number of rendering jobs processed per quarter, the growth in active node operators, the volume of RNDR tokens burned through network usage, and new strategic partnerships with content creation platforms.
